Here, using Fleming's left hand rule, the force on the positive charges will be towards the edge "1-4" and the force on the electrons will be towards the edge "2-3". This force will move (displace) the free electrons in the entire conductor towards "2-3". This will produce excess number of negatively charged electrons in the region of "2-3". So the surface/edge "2-3" will be negatively charged. And since the free electrons have come from "1-4", there will be deficiency of electons at "1-4". So, "1-4" will be positively charged.
